If you are planning to buy a sedan that looks like a sports car in the future, keep in mind the Lamborghini Estoque. This one is the most recent concept car unveiled by the company on the eve of the 2008 Paris Auto Show. This latest design is a 4-door, 4-seater supersaloon that’s sure to amaze anyone. A car with a 4-door design is the latest trend especially in new markets in Russia and in the east, and Lamborghini is capitalizing on this inclination in selling the Estoque. Even though this particular model is equipped with four doors, there can be no doubt about it being a Lamborghini.
This Lamborghini Estoque is a very streamlined piece of work. It is 154.7-inches long, 78.4-inches wide, and 53.2-icnhes low. The Lamborghini mark is evident in its overall design starting from the four-door aluminum body, wedge-shape front end, and tautly drawn surfacing. All of these are installed on durable but lightweight aluminum space frame. Right below it features huge 23-inch wheels equipped with 295/30ZR23 Pirelli Zero Rosso tires.
However, it’s not merely show for the Lamborghini Estoque concept. It is also capable of revving up excellent road performance since it is equipped with 5.2-liter V10 engine. At an estimate, this engine is expected to provide the car with speed up to 100 km/h at4.5 second start-up. In the meantime this is the only engine available, but if ever this goes into production the company is also planning to provide more practical engine choices like a twin-turbocharged 4.0-liter V8 or a 4.8-liter V8 diesel engine.
The Lamborghini Estoque is definitely something new in the Lamborghini lineup. If I’m not mistaken, this is the first model to come in a 4-door design. Because of this, the company is still gauging the public’s reaction before it commits it to production. This car will likely come with a price tag of $230,000, but don’t expect it to be in stores by Christmas.
By the way, its name is also the name of bullfighter’s sword which is also estoque.
